POSTER DESIGN Adelaide Fringe Festival 2010 "Kings and Queens"
 
 
Using the non traditional hireachy of kings and queens I created a parody, that the women is always in charge. I used simple vector illustrations to bring this idea to life. The women is portrayed as the strength, and the man as a weak worker who climbs his way to the top. It turned out to be a little feminist, but in a light hearted way to reverse the roles of king and queen. 
My inspiration for the design came from the Adelaide fringe festival, it encourages fresh design, art, and cutlure. This playful anacdote revives feminism and evokes humour for the social roles of man and women.
